The Complexity of Securing Application Access
Managing access to applications isn’t just about user authentication. You also need to account for access roles, permissions, compliance audits, and ensuring proper monitoring of user behavior. The more fragmented your ecosystem, the higher the risk of permissions unintentionally opening up security vulnerabilities.
You can’t manually monitor everyone’s access to applications, track anomalous behavior in real-time, and ensure every team member aligns with your security policies. Manual interventions are time-consuming and prone to delays, leading to risks such as unauthorized access or non-compliance.
Auto-remediation workflows tackle these challenges head-on. By embedding automated systems that act on predefined policies, these workflows catch and fix issues immediately, whether that’s revoking excessive permissions, locking suspicious accounts, or sending out alerts.
How Auto-Remediation Enhances Security
Auto-remediation workflows address security risks with speed and precision. Here’s how:
1. Automated Detection of Access Anomalies
When users act outside established norms (e.g., using privileged access during odd hours or accessing apps they shouldn’t), traditional systems might flag the violation. Auto-remediation takes this further by responding immediately, such as by downgrading access, generating incident reports, or alerting administrators.
